Well I am now determined to get more sleep especially after reading other things that can happen to you due to the lack of zzzzzz's:
* Impaired mood, memory, and concentration. When you don’t get enough sleep, you’re less productive, not more. Lack of sleep affects your ability to concentrate and remember things. What’s more, it makes you irritable and cranky. As a result, you’re social and decision-making skills suffer
* Dampened immune system. Without adequate sleep, the immune system becomes weak, making you more vulnerable to colds, flu, and other infections and diseases. And if you get sick, it takes you longer to recover.
* Increased risk of accidents. Did you know that driving while seriously sleep deprived is similar to driving while drunk? The lack of motor coordination associated with sleep deprivation also makes you more susceptible to falls and injury.

so, how do we get better sleep ??
To prepare for sleep, try

* Reading a light, entertaining book or magazine
* Listening to soft music
* Making simple preparations for the next day
* A light bedtime snack, a cup of hot tea, or a glass of warm milk
* Hobbies such as knitting or jigsaw puzzles
* Listening to books on tape
Also, If you can’t stop yourself from worrying, especially about things outside your control, take steps to learn how to manage your thoughts. For example, you can reframe why worrying is harmful rather than helpful and practice replacing worrying with more productive thoughts.
